OPC-30144 – OPC UA for PROFINET GSD Generic Model - Part 30144: PROFINET GSD Generic Model3.2.11 DeviceDevice A Device is a separate addressable unit exchanging IO Data with a Controller . Devices are usually configured by the Controller and may also generate acyclic data like Alarms ... diagnostic information. A Device may consist of several modules and Submodules . The IO Data , the Parameters, the Alarms, and the Data Objects of a Device are described in the GSDML

OPC-30144 – OPC UA for PROFINET GSD Generic Model - Part 30144: PROFINET GSD Generic Model3.2.12 ControllerController A Controller is a host running a program which reads and writes the IO Data of one or more Devices
